What is Maize Quest®?
Hugh McPherson, and the McPherson family, launched
Maize Quest® in 1997 on their farm in York County, Pennsylvania. Maize
Quest® in York County has become America’s Only Maze Theme Park, an
educational attraction created on 15 acres of Maple Lawn Farms.
Maize Quest® appeals to families because it engages
both parents and children, challenges them to work together, and rewards
them with a sense of accomplishment. Maize Quest® is an attraction that
draws children outdoors, away from television and computers, where they
can interact with their parents in an exciting environment. Because of
our excellent in-maze activities, Maize Quest® also attracts school
groups, scout troops, church youth, and corporate team building groups.
Attendance at Maize Quest® in York County grew from
7,000 in 1997 to over 44,000 in three seasons through an extensive
public relations campaign and the return of satisfied customers. Maize
Quest® customers return to the maze for a variety of reasons. They
return to gain mastery of the maze, to challenge friends and family, to
conquer a new maze design, and to experience the maze at a different
time of day or season.
Maize Quest® organizers plan future expansion through
strategic partnerships with top quality farm operators across the
country. The 2003 Maize Quest® system entertained over 250,000 people at
our 27 North American locations. In 2004, Maize Quest® is building its
product offering to encompass four major categories of maze-based
attractions.
